Abstract

Recent studies have shown that type 2 diabetes is not only associated with cardiovascular disease (CVD), but the presence of heart failure contributes to the development of type 2 diabetes. different risk of complications and mortality, as well as the progression of renal failure. The predictive potential of HbA1c's unique ability to assess retrospective glycemic control can be applied as part of a diagnostic and prognostic tool.
